Jaques leads Rockets to win

February 3, 2023

Petrolia‘s Andrew Jaques opened the scoring with a first period power play goal and added two assists to lead the Strathroy Rockets to a 6-4 win over the Legionnaies Thursday night at the Pat Stapleton Arena.

Former Legionnaire Matthew Balloch had two assists and Sting draft choice Dylan Grover made 35 saves for the goaltending win.

Sarnia rallied from a 5-1 deficit in the third period to make the score 5-4 but the visitors iced the game with their fourth goal on the man advantage with just under seven minutes to play in regulation time.

Ty Moffatt, Nathan Lavender, Adam Maitland and Dylan Dupuis scored for the Legionnaires. Tyler Richardson made his goaltending debut for Sarnia and made 37 stops.

The Legionnaires remain in eight place in the Western Conference four points up on Komoka. The Rockets are tied for fifth with Chatham.

Sarnia is off until they take on the Lincolns in St. Marys on Friday, Feb. 10.

Strathroy is home to St. Thomas tomorrow (Sat) night and take on the Kings in Komoka on Sunday afternoon.
